How to Decide When to Take the GRE Exam?

1.      Based on Application Deadline

The universities release date or deadline to apply. Make sure you take at least 3 months to prepare for GRE test. It is not a healthy practice to wait until the last moment to take the test. And give a minimum of 4 months for preparation. So in total, you should start the GRE preparation eight months before admissions.

Why 8 months? If you have 8 months, you can prepare for the GRE test properly. Even if your score is not satisfying, there will be time to re-take the GRE test.

2.      Make sure you can have time to prepare for the GRE:

To prepare for a test like GRE, you need ample time and dedication. So make sure you are ready with time and resources. If you are in a situation where you need to work more and have less time to prepare or any family disturbances where you can least concentrate, it is better to postpone the test.

3.      Make sure of the finances:

Deciding on taking GRE means planning to go abroad for education which is interlink with your finances. So it is better to plan your finances and then decide.

4.      Check whether you are ready to go to Grad School

This parameter is also important. Because most of the seniors choose to take some time before they go for a Masters. Better to think about future goals before grad school rather than after grad school. Meanwhile, you can find your other interests too. So take your time and set your goal.

5.      When to take the GRE test for Fall Admission?

If you plan for fall admissions, take the GRE test in September or October of the previous year.

6.      When to take the GRE test for Spring Admission?

If you plan for spring admissions, take the GRE test in January – February of the previous year.

7.      How much time will it take to get GRE score?

It will take 10-15 days to get a GRE scorecard. Even though it takes just 15 days, it may take approximately 3 weeks for the GRE score to reach the University mails. And it may take another week to reach the respective department officials. So as per these timelines, plan to get a Good GRE score to get into Top Universities .

Can You Use a Calculator on the GMAT Test?

  The answer for the biggest question for most of the GMAT test takers- “Can I use a calculator on the GMAT Test?” is both yes and no. Keep reading to clear all your queries on the calculator usage in GMAT along with the tips to survive without a calculator on the GMAT test. Is Calculator allowed on GMAT Test? GMAT test has Quantitative and Integrated reasoning sections, where no calculator is allowed in the Quantitative section and an on-screen calculator will be available for the integrated reasoning section. So, no physical calculator can be allowed on the GMAT test day. How can I solve GMAT Quant without a calculator? To be frank, the GMAT Quant section does not need any calculator. The test is designed in a way that no complex mathematic problems that take much time for calculations, or which need a calculator, will be asked in the GMAT Quant section. How to Solve GMAT Terminating and Repeating Decimals?

Solving decimals can be the trickiest part of the GMAT Math. But to reach the perfect score, one needs to master even the tricky parts. If decimals are bothering you, here are some shortcuts and tricks to solve GMAT Terminating and Repeating Decimals. Before heading to the shortcuts first understand decimals and their types. Rational Numbers:  A rational number is nothing but the ratio of two integers. Integers are the set of positive and negative whole numbers including zero. It means, {……, -3, -2, -1, 0, 1, 2, 3, 4.....}. So the ratio of two integers gives a rational number. Rational numbers include all fractions along with integers because 4/1=4. Decimals from rational numbers: Let us understand the basics of decimals once again. When a decimal is made out of a fraction, it either terminates or repeats. Only these chances are there for decimals. Understand the concept of fractions to  score more in the GMAT Math section . Terminating decimals means, ½ =0.5 1/8 = 0.125
